Music:
Course, Club and Ensemble Information
Grade
Nine Music-AMI 1O
This course is designed to introduce students to traditional concert
band instruments. This course emphasizes the performance of music
at a level that strikes a balance between challenge and skill and
is aimed at developing technique, sensitivity and imagination. Students
will participate in creative activities teach them to listen with
understanding. They will also learn correct musical terminology
and its appropriate use.

Grade
Ten Music-AMI 2O
This course emphasizes performance of music at an intermediate
level that strikes a balance between challenge and skill. Student
learning will include participating in creative activities and listening
perceptively. Students will also be required to develop a thorough
understanding of the language of music, including the elements,
terminology, and history. This course has an increased focus on
the use of technology with music.

Grade
Eleven Music-AMA 3M
The Grade 11-university/college music curriculum is designed
to broaden the students’ knowledge and skills in performance,
composing, arranging, listening and analysis, music in society, and
music and technology. It emphasizes the appreciation, analysis and performance
of various kinds of music. Students perform technical exercises and
appropriate repertoire, compose and arrange their own music, and analyse
live and recorded performances. This course is performance-based, and
although performance is a unit unto its own, it is expected that performance
be infused in all units of study at this grade level. Students also
continue to explore possible careers in or related to music.
Grade
Twelve Music-AMA 4M
This course emphasizes the appreciation, analysis, and performance
of music from the Twentieth Century, including art music, jazz, popular
music, and Canadian and non-Western music. Students will concentrate
on developing interpretive skills and the ability to work independently.
They will also complete complex creative projects.
Grimsby
Bands and Practice Schedules
Junior Band
This group is geared to experienced instrumentalists who are currently
in grades 9 or 10. It provides an opportunity to work on band repertoire
in a large group setting. Gr 9 students with prior experience are encouraged
to participate in this ensemble. This group rehearses once a week.
Jazz
Band
Selected from the concert band, this small group of saxes, trumpets,
trombones, and rhythm section plays a wide range of jazz material. Concerts
include school performances, community events, and various festivals.
.
Percussion Ensemble
This group is made up of 8-10 auditioned students who have extensive
experience in instrumental music.
String
Ensemble
The GSS string ensemble is geared to the experienced string player.
This student-directed group performs within the community each year
and is involved in festivals and annual school concerts. Students are
required to supply their own instruments.
Vocal
Music Classes and Choir
Grade
Nine Vocal -AMV 1O
This course emphasizes performance of music at an intermediate
level that strikes a balance between challenge and skill. Student learning
will include participating in creative activities and listening perceptively.
Students will also be required to develop a thorough understanding of
the language of music, including the elements, terminology, and history.
Grade
Eleven Vocal -AMV 3M
This focus course in vocal music will provide students
in the college/ university course with the opportunity to learn to further
refine their vocal music skills. Students will also have the opportunity
to learn challenging repertoire as they continue their study of music
theory, history and analysis.
Grade
Twelve Vocal -AMV 4M
This focus course in vocal music will provide students
with the opportunity to learn to further refine their vocal music skills.
Students will also have the opportunity to learn challenging repertoire
as they continue their study of music theory, history and analysis.
Grimsby
Choir
This ensemble is open to all students who enjoy singing at any level.
The group explores a wide variety of music and performs at the school
and at various festivals. No experience is required other than the keen
desire to sing! The music department offers a wide variety of ensembles
for all levels of ability. Whether you are an instrumentalist or a vocalist,
we hope you will be involved in one or more of our extra-curricular
groups. Students from the entire student body are welcome to participate.
Annual events include Christmas and Spring concerts, as well as participation
in provincial music festivals.
